What is a battery discharge curve?

The discharge curve is a plot of voltage against percentage of capacity discharged. A flat discharge curve is desirable as this means that the voltage remains constant as the battery is used up.

What is the Li ion battery discharge curve is?

The discharge curves for a Lithium Ion cell below show that the effective capacity of the cell is reduced if the cell is discharged at very high rates (or conversely increased with low discharge rates). This is called the capacity offset and the effect is common to most cell chemistries.

What is C5 rating of battery?

WhAt IS BAttery CApACIty? Traction batteries usually have a C rating: C5, C10, C20 or C100. This is the rated capacity of the batteries when discharged over 5 hours (C5), 10 hours (C10), 20 hours (C20) and 100 hours (C100). The longer you take to discharge the battery the more amp hours are available.

What is charging and discharging of battery?

Charging a battery reverses the chemical process that occurred during discharge. The electrical energy used to charge a battery is converted back to chemical energy and stored inside the battery. Battery chargers, including alternators and generators, produce a higher voltage than the battery’s open circuit voltage.

What is capacity of battery?

“Battery capacity” is a measure (typically in Amp-hr) of the charge stored by the battery, and is determined by the mass of active material contained in the battery. The battery capacity represents the maximum amount of energy that can be extracted from the battery under certain specified conditions.

What is 50 discharge of a 12V battery?

A Specific Gravity of about 1.200 or a voltage of 12.25 to 12.3 means the battery is about 50% discharged. By the time it’s down to 11.8 or 12 volts, it’s almost dead.
